Bulgaria asked 103 countries to open polling stations for coming elections

Bulgaria has sent notes to a total of 103 countries, asking them to open polling stations for the coming parliamentary elections in May.

So far 38 countries have answered positively. 22 countries did not allow opening polling stations outside the Bulgarian consulates. Among them are Hungary, Slovakia, Ukraine, Georgia, Japan, China, India and others.
